Title: Red Bull on Head Hunt
Post by: Wizzo on April 05, 2006, 12:02:05 PM
 
Red Bull Racing have confirmed that Keith Saunt will join the team in the next few months, as their operations director.

A brief statement from the Milton Keynes based squad read:

"Red Bull Racing is pleased to announce that Keith Saunt will be joining the team as operations director. With more than 15 years experience in Formula One, Keith will join the team from Renault later this year."

Red Bull have been on a major recruitment drive in recent months, with former McLaren technical director Adrian Newey their most prominent scalp. They have also signed McLaren chief aerodynamicist, Peter Prodromou. Although Prodromou will continue to work at McLaren for the remainder of this year, he will link up with Newey, when his contract with Ron Dennis' team expires.
